概括
SmartHypnos X 是一个新的免费 MATLAB 工具箱,用于自动测试睡眠阶段和呼吸事件. 它的准确性很高,与专家的意见相提并论,对于睡眠专家来说也很方便.

主要方法:
- 开发了一个带有图形用户界面的集成 MATLAB 工具箱 SmartHypnos X.
- 多模式和多睡眠时间序列数据的可视化
- 使用8879个睡眠时段 (每个时段为30秒) 的大型数据集进行验证.
主要成果:
- 智能Hypnos X实现了超过84%的自动睡眠分期准确度,与专家间的协议相提并论.
- 自动呼吸事件检测准确度超过90%.
- 睡眠专家对该工具箱的易用性,可学习性和功能性进行了积极评价.

Sleep apnea is a condition where breathing stops intermittently during sleep, often leading to significant health issues. Each episode can last from 10 to 20 seconds or more and is frequently accompanied by a brief arousal from sleep. This disturbance, largely unnoticed by the individual, can lead to severe daytime fatigue. Commonly, individuals seek help after being informed by their partners about loud snoring and noticeable breathing pauses during sleep.

The neural regulation of respiration is a meticulously coordinated process primarily controlled by the respiratory centers located within the brainstem. These centers, composed of specialized neurons, transmit nerve impulses that control the contraction and relaxation of our respiratory muscles.
